Engine Oil
6. Refill the engine with the recom-
mended oil.
Engine oil change capacity
(including filter):
(US: DX, LX, Canada: LX, EX)
3.8
(4.0 US qt, 3.3 Imp qt)
(US: EX, Canada: EX-R)
4.3
(4.5 US qt, 3.8 Imp qt)
(US:LXV-6,EXV-6,Canada:EX
V-6.
EX-R V-6)
4.4
(4.6 US qt,3.9 Imp qt)
7. Replace the engine oil fill cap.
Start the engine. The oil pressure
indicator light should go out within
five seconds. If it does not, turn off
the engine and reinspect your
work.
8. Let the engine run for several
minutes and check the drain bolt
and oil filter for leaks.
9. Turn off the engine, let it sit for
several minutes, then checkthe oil
level. If necessary, add oil to bring
the level to the upper mark on the
dipstick.
If you change your own oil, please
dispose of the used oil properly. Put it
in a sealed container and take it to a
recycling center. Do not discard it in a
trash bin or dump it on the ground.
The oil and filter should be changed
every 6 months or 12,000 km (7,500
miles), whichever comes first. Under
severe driving conditions, they
should be changed every 3 months
or 6,000 km (3,750 miles). See page
143
for a description of severe
driving conditions.
